main.svelte-1x05zx6{max-width:22rem;margin:0 auto;padding:5rem 1.5rem 3rem}h1.svelte-1x05zx6{text-align:center;color:#6f4e37;margin:0;font-size:2rem}.subtitle.svelte-1x05zx6{text-align:center;color:#8a7563;margin:.25rem 0 2.5rem}form.svelte-1x05zx6{flex-direction:column;gap:1.25rem;display:flex}label.svelte-1x05zx6{color:#5c4a3d;flex-direction:column;gap:.4rem;font-size:.95rem;display:flex}input.svelte-1x05zx6{font:inherit;color:#3a2e26;background:#fffdfa;border:1px solid #d6c7b6;border-radius:8px;padding:.6rem .7rem}input.svelte-1x05zx6:focus{outline-offset:1px;border-color:#b08d5b;outline:2px solid #b08d5b}button.svelte-1x05zx6{font:inherit;color:#fdf8f2;cursor:pointer;background:#6f4e37;border:none;border-radius:8px;margin-top:.5rem;padding:.65rem 1rem}button.svelte-1x05zx6:hover:not(:disabled){background:#5c4030}button.svelte-1x05zx6:disabled{opacity:.7;cursor:default}.error.svelte-1x05zx6{color:#8a3b2a;background:#f7e4df;border:1px solid #e0b4a8;border-radius:8px;margin:0;padding:.7rem .8rem;font-size:.95rem}
